Should be a piece of cake. Talk to some of the guys at Arizona Yacht Club for any pointers. I sailed there for decades on 26-27 footers. You will want to be sure you have a marine VHF, coastal and Catalina charts and read about picking up moorings in the Two Harbors Cruisers' Guide (see link). The good news is you can probably go on the string line, so there should be plenty of room for you there. Anchoring takes a LOT of rode; it's deep in most of Catalina unless you are lucky enough to get some of the shallower spots.
